Choreo LLC grew its holdings in shares of AerCap Holdings (NYSE:AER - Free Report) by 115.9%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 12,032 shares of the financial services provider's stock after acquiring an additional 6,459 shares during the period. Choreo LLC's holdings in AerCap were worth $1,149,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

AerCap Holdings N.V. engages in the lease, financing, sale, and management of commercial flight equipment in China, Hong Kong, Macau, the United States, Ireland, and internationally. The company offers aircraft asset management services, such as remarketing aircraft and engines; collecting rental and maintenance rent payments, monitoring aircraft maintenance, monitoring and enforcing contract compliance, and accepting delivery and redelivery of aircraft and engines; and conducting ongoing lessee financial performance reviews.
